About Chambal Fertilisers and Chemicals Limited

Chambal Fertilisers and Chemicals Limited manufactures and distributes fertilizers and agrochemicals in India through four operating segments: Own Manufactured Fertilisers, Complex Fertilisers, Crop Protection Chemicals and Speciality Nutrients, and Others. The company produces urea, di-ammonium phosphate, muriate of potash, triple super phosphate, and NPK fertilizers, alongside technical grade agrochemicals and formulated crop protection products.
